J4 ›› 2013, Vol. 35 ›› Issue (6): 15-23.
• 论文 • Previous Articles Next Articles
ZHAO Jianming1,YAO Nianmin2,HAN Yong2,CAI Shaobin2
Received:
Revised:
Online:
Published:
Abstract:
Due to the bandwidth restriction and the long delay of IP network, iSCSI initiator and iSCSI target have to wait for a longer time until they acknowledge the status or the control command sent by the other party. The communication of iSCSI protocol takes a large part of the total cost. Therefore, the cache data's loading cost of iSCSI storage is different from the traditional direct attached storage. The existing researches focused on achieving high cache hit ratios, but rarely paid attention to reducing the loading cost of miss data for improving the storage system performance. In the paper, a cache replacement algorithm called CFL-LRU (LRU Combined with Frequency and data Length) was proposed for iSCSI storage. The algorithm not only considers the time and the frequency but also takes into account the logical block address continuity of pages, thereby compromising the hit rate and the miss penalty. Our tracedriven simulation results show that, for different kinds of workloads and cache size, the CFL-LRU outperforms the others.
Key words: iSCSI;network storage;replacement algorithm;hit ratio;miss penalty
ZHAO Jianming1,YAO Nianmin2,HAN Yong2,CAI Shaobin2. A novel cache replacement algorithm for iSCSI storage [J]. J4, 2013, 35(6): 15-23.
0 / / Recommend
Add to citation manager EndNote|Ris|BibTeX
URL: http://joces.nudt.edu.cn/EN/
http://joces.nudt.edu.cn/EN/Y2013/V35/I6/15